1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an integer?

Back

An integer is a whole number that can be positive, negative, or zero, but does not include fractions or decimals.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you multiply two integers with different signs?

Back

When multiplying two integers with different signs, the product is negative.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the product of -3 and 4?

Back

The product of -3 and 4 is -12.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the product of two negative integers?

Back

The product of two negative integers is positive.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you divide integers?

Back

To divide integers, divide the absolute values and apply the sign rules: if the signs are the same, the result is positive; if the signs are different, the result is negative.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the result of dividing -20 by 4?

Back

The result of dividing -20 by 4 is -5.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the average of a set of numbers?

Back

The average is calculated by adding all the numbers together and then dividing by the count of the numbers.
